Although the food is tasty, the portion is on the smaller size especially for the price. Be aware, the price one the menu is cash price. It is stated in the small print on the bottom. They charge 4% for credit card transactions, as well as for zelle or Venmo payment.

I had heard great things about this restaurant in Chino from friends and Yelp reviews, so my expectations were high. My girlfriend and I had been looking forward to dining here for a while, and we decided to celebrate our 3 year anniversary here this past Wednesday night.

The night started off on a positive note: the restaurant had a cozy ambiance with pleasant music, and the staff left a personalized anniversary card with heart confetti on our table -- a thoughtful touch I appreciated since I had mentioned our celebration in the reservation.

Unfortunately, that's where the positives ended.

Our server, Jordan, was friendly but clearly inexperienced. He struggled with multitasking and took longer than expected to take our order using the tablet. Both my girlfriend and I have past experiences in the restaurant industry as servers, so we know this wasn't due to a busy night -- the place was relatively slow. Jordan also didn't seem knowledgeable about the menu or ingredients, and he kept running back and forth to the kitchen for basic questions.

He recommended the swordfish with eggplant as the special of the night, which my girlfriend ordered, and I got the Wagyu Ribeye. I asked for grilled onions on the side -- a pretty standard topping request at most gourmet bistros -- but was told they weren't available. Odd, but I let it go. Thankfully, my steak came out perfectly cooked and well-seasoned.

The real issue came with the swordfish with eggplant dish. Right away, my girlfriend commented that it was dry and completely bland. I tasted it myself and agreed -- it was far from the standard you'd expect, especially for a nightly special. We flagged it to Jordan, who didn't show much empathy or concern. He simply said he'd take it back. We requested the salmon instead.

To make matters worse, it took over 25 minutes for the replacement dish to arrive. By then, my ribeye was cold since I had waited to eat with my girlfriend. Again, Jordan didn't acknowledge the delay or offer to accommodate us in any meaningful way. He lacked the attentiveness and awareness expected at a higher-end restaurant, and it really put a damper on what was supposed to be a special night.

When the bill came, the swordfish dish (which we didn't eat) was removed -- which is fair -- but no other accommodation was offered for the overall inconvenience. We had to ask if anything else could be done. Jordan went to speak with a manager and returned offering either 10% off the replacement dish or removing a glass of basic champagne from the bill. He laughed while presenting the options, which came across as unprofessional and dismissive given the situation.

In the end, while I appreciated the personalized card and initial gesture, the poor service, disappointing food quality (especially the special), and lack of accountability really soured the experience.

This place might be great on other nights, and I understand not every experience is perfect -- but I felt it was important to share our honest experience so others celebrating something meaningful aren't left feeling like we did.
